General Information about #18192F
The hexadecimal color code #18192F represents a dark shade of blue-purple. It is composed of 9.41% red, 9.8% green, and 18.43% blue. In the RGB color model, this translates to the values R:24, G:25, B:47. In the CMYK color model, it is composed of 49% cyan, 47% magenta, 0% yellow and 82% black. The color #18192F, also known as Mirage, presents some accessibility challenges, particularly concerning text contrast. When using this color as a background, it is crucial to select foreground text colors that provide sufficient contrast to ensure readability for individuals with visual impairments. According to WCAG guidelines, a contrast ratio of at least 4.5:1 is recommended for normal text and 3:1 for large text. White or light shades of gray and yellow would generally work well as text on the mirage background. It is highly advisable to use contrast checking tools during the design and development process to verify compliance with accessibility standards. Furthermore, avoid using this color for essential interactive elements without careful consideration of focus states and hover effects, ensuring that these states are clearly distinguishable for all users.
